To remove the child restraint, press the release
button on the buckle and then pull the lap/shoulder
belt out of the restraint and allow the safety belt to
retract fully.

WARNING - Auto Lock Mode
The lap/shoulder belt automatically returns
to the "emergency lock mode" whenever the
belt is allowed to retract fully. Therefore, the
preceding seven steps must be followed
each time a child restraint is installed.
If the safety belt is not placed in the "auto
lock" mode, severe injury or death could
occur to the child and/or other occupants in
the vehicle in a collision, since the child
restraint will not be effectively held in place.

✽ ✽ NOTICE
When the safety belt is allowed to retract to its
fully stowed position, the retractor will auto-
matically switch from the "Auto Lock" mode
to the emergency lock mode for normal adult
usage.
